#DD99B2 Hex color

#DD99B2

The hexadecimal color code #DD99B2 corresponds to the code RGB( 221, 153, 178 ). It's a shade of Red. This color is a combination of red (at 0,87 level), green (at 0,60 level) and blue (at 0,70 level). Its brightness is 73% and its saturation is 50%. It is composed of red at 40%, green at 27% and blue at 32%.
